About the Business

Green Papaya is a vibrant and inviting restaurant located at 16893 Northwest 67th Avenue in Hialeah, Florida. Specializing in authentic Asian cuisine, Green Papaya offers a diverse menu featuring traditional dishes from countries such as Thailand, Vietnam, and China. The restaurant prides itself on using fresh, locally sourced ingredients to create flavorful and artfully presented dishes. With a cozy atmosphere and friendly staff, Green Papaya is the perfect spot for a delicious and satisfying meal. Whether you're craving a spicy curry, a refreshing noodle salad, or a savory stir-fry, Green Papaya has something for everyone to enjoy.

Melissa:
5

"Love the Beef Pho! It is legit. This is my favorite Pho place in the Miami Lakes area and in my top 3 in South Florida! Compared to other Vietnamese places, they are a little more frugal in the ingredients for the pho, but it still hits the spot, and it is perfectly portioned. The beef broth flavor is smooth and tasty! I add their Hoisen and Sriracha for a little kick."
